Kim Kardashian Dazzles In Business + Philanthropy

Kim Kardashian decided to make an enormous move with business partner Brian Lee by making a $40 million investment.  However, this is not your average investment, so the two chose Andreessen Horowitz — who happens to be an investor in Facebook, Foursquare, Groupon, Skype and Twitter — as their guide.  Kardashian wanted to use him specifically for her 2-year-old footwear and accessories e-commerce venture, ShoeDazzle.  Lee is a strong believer that this move will help ShoeDazzle gain customer interest and international awareness.

“We are launching in the U.K. in the next couple of months,” he said, noting that the firm is also in discussions to expand into Asia by the end of the year and South America after that.

John O’Farrell, general partner recently stated that ShoeDazzle.com has more than 3 million subscribers.  Horowitz believes that ShoeDazzle is going to be extremely successful due to the fact that the site receives regular customer traffic.  After three different financing rounds, the site has attracted more than $60 million in venture capital financing.

With lots of funding behind her company, Kim Kardashian wants to show her philanthropic side with her participation in the Project trade show launch of Denim Unites for Peace.

Denim Unites for Peace is an online charitable fund-raising sale benefiting Falling Whistles.  Some of the other denim brands participating are Joe’s Jeans, True Religion, Hudson, Citizens of Humanity, J Brand, Current/Elliott, Siwy, Acne, Nudie, Kasil, AG Adriano Goldschmied and Seven For All Mankind.  On May 18th HauteLook, which was acquired by Nordstrom will host the 3 day sale.  All denim pieces will retail for under $100 and all of the money will go to the war affected children and women of Congo.
